
在低代码开发中,页面性能的设置和优化是非常关键的,这不仅影响用户体验,还直接关系到应用的稳定性和响应速度。要优化低代码页面性能,可以从以下几个方面入手:1、选择高效的低代码平台,2、合理使用缓存,3、优化数据查询,4、减少页面加载时间,5、进行代码优化。下面我们将详细介绍这些方法。
一、选择高效的低代码平台
选择一个高效的低代码平台是优化页面性能的首要步骤。简道云低代码平台在这方面表现出色,提供了强大的功能和灵活的配置选项。
简道云低代码平台的优势:
- 高性能的数据处理能力: 简道云低代码平台支持大规模数据处理和实时数据分析,能够有效提升页面性能。
- 灵活的组件: 提供多种预定义组件和模板,能够快速构建高效的页面。
- 内置优化工具: 平台自带性能监控和优化工具,可以实时监测页面性能,并提供优化建议。
- 云端支持: 利用云端资源,实现高效的数据存储和处理,提升页面加载速度。
简道云低代码平台官网地址: https://s.fanruan.com/x6aj1;
二、合理使用缓存
缓存是一种提高页面性能的重要手段,通过将频繁访问的数据存储在缓存中,可以减少数据查询和处理的时间。
缓存策略:
- 浏览器缓存: 将静态资源(如图片、CSS、JavaScript 文件)缓存到用户的浏览器中,减少每次加载的时间。
- 服务器缓存: 在服务器端设置缓存,将常用的数据存储在缓存中,减少数据库查询的次数。
- 应用缓存: 在应用内使用缓存机制,将频繁访问的数据缓存起来,提升数据读取速度。
实施缓存的步骤:
- 确定需要缓存的数据和资源。
- 配置缓存策略,如设置缓存时间、缓存位置等。
- 定期清理和更新缓存,确保数据的时效性和准确性。
三、优化数据查询
数据查询的效率直接影响页面的加载速度和响应时间,通过优化数据查询,可以显著提升页面性能。
优化数据查询的方法:
- 使用索引: 在数据库表中为频繁查询的字段建立索引,提升查询速度。
- 减少查询次数: 合理设计数据结构,减少不必要的查询次数。
- 批量查询: 将多次查询合并为一次批量查询,减少数据库交互次数。
- 优化查询语句: 使用高效的查询语句,避免全表扫描等低效操作。
实例说明:
例如,在一个用户管理系统中,可以为用户表的用户名和邮箱字段建立索引,这样在进行用户登录验证时,可以显著提升查询速度。
四、减少页面加载时间
页面加载时间是衡量页面性能的重要指标,通过优化页面加载时间,可以提升用户体验。
减少页面加载时间的方法:
- 压缩静态资源: 使用工具对CSS、JavaScript文件进行压缩,减少文件大小。
- 使用CDN: 将静态资源托管到CDN(内容分发网络),提升资源加载速度。
- 异步加载资源: 对非关键资源使用异步加载,避免阻塞页面的渲染。
- 延迟加载: 对图片、视频等资源使用延迟加载技术,只有在用户滚动到对应位置时才加载。
实施步骤:
- 对页面中的静态资源进行压缩和优化。
- 配置CDN,将静态资源托管到CDN上。
- 修改页面代码,使用异步加载和延迟加载技术。
五、进行代码优化
代码优化是提升页面性能的重要手段,通过优化代码,可以减少不必要的计算和操作,提高执行效率。
代码优化的方法:
- 精简代码: 删除冗余代码和注释,减少代码体积。
- 减少DOM操作: 尽量减少对DOM的操作,优化渲染流程。
- 使用高效算法: 选择高效的算法和数据结构,提升代码执行效率。
- 避免全局变量: 避免使用全局变量,减少命名冲突和内存泄漏。
实例说明:
例如,在一个页面中,如果需要对大量数据进行排序,可以选择使用快速排序算法,而不是冒泡排序算法,从而提升排序效率。
总结
通过以上方法,可以有效优化低代码页面的性能,提升用户体验和应用的稳定性。选择高效的低代码平台(如简道云低代码平台)、合理使用缓存、优化数据查询、减少页面加载时间和进行代码优化是提升页面性能的关键步骤。希望这些方法能够帮助你更好地理解和应用低代码页面性能优化技术,打造高效、稳定的低代码应用。
进一步的建议:
- 定期监测页面性能,及时发现和解决性能瓶颈。
- 不断学习和应用最新的性能优化技术,保持技术的先进性。
- 与团队成员分享性能优化经验,共同提升应用的性能和质量。
相关问答FAQs:
低代码开发平台中的页面性能优化有哪些常见方法?
在低代码开发平台中,页面性能优化通常包括多种策略,例如减少页面加载时间、优化资源使用和提升用户交互响应速度。开发者可以通过以下方式进行优化:
- 图片和媒体文件的优化:使用压缩工具减小文件大小,选择合适的格式(如WebP)以加快加载速度。
- 懒加载技术:仅在用户滚动到特定区域时加载图片和媒体文件,从而减少初始页面加载的资源消耗。
- 使用CDN(内容分发网络):将静态资源托管在CDN上,用户访问时会从离他们最近的服务器获取资源,显著提升加载速度。
- 减少HTTP请求:合并CSS和JavaScript文件,减少请求数量,有助于提高页面加载速度。
- 优化数据库查询:确保对数据库的查询是高效的,使用索引和缓存技术来减少数据库访问的延迟。
在低代码平台中如何监测和分析页面性能?
监测和分析页面性能可以通过多种工具和技术实现,以下是一些有效的方法:
- 使用浏览器开发者工具:大多数现代浏览器都内置了开发者工具,可以实时监测网络请求、资源加载时间和性能指标。
- 集成性能监测工具:如Google Lighthouse、New Relic或Pingdom等,这些工具提供了详细的性能分析报告和建议。
- 用户行为分析:利用用户行为分析工具(如Hotjar或Google Analytics)来了解用户在页面上的交互情况,发现潜在的性能瓶颈。
- 定期进行性能测试:定期执行压力测试和负载测试,确保应用在高流量情况下仍能保持良好的性能。
低代码开发平台如何优化移动端页面性能?
为了优化移动端页面性能,开发者可以采取以下措施:
- 响应式设计:确保页面能够根据不同设备自动调整布局和内容,避免不必要的元素加载。
- 减少重定向:尽量减少页面重定向次数,减少移动设备上的延迟。
- 使用轻量级框架:选择轻量级的前端框架和库,避免使用过于庞大的资源。
- 优化脚本和样式表的加载:将JavaScript和CSS文件放在页面底部,确保页面的主要内容能够尽快加载和显示。
- 实施PWA(渐进式Web应用):利用PWA的特性,提高用户在移动设备上的体验,减少网络请求并实现离线访问。
为了高效搭建企业管理系统,建议使用一个优秀的零代码开发平台。该平台能够让用户在短时间内完成管理软件的搭建,十分适合不具备编程技能的用户。推荐链接如下:
推荐一个好用的零代码开发平台,5分钟即可搭建一个管理软件:
https://s.fanruan.com/x6aj1
100+企业管理系统模板免费使用>>>无需下载,在线安装:
https://s.fanruan.com/7wtn5
阅读时间:7 分钟
浏览量:654次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








